Introduction: Preeclampsia is a serious obstetrical syndrome
characterized by hypertension, proteinuria, generalized edema and
generalized vasospasm, which affects ~7% of pregnant women. Despite
its recognition since antiquity, the current treatment of this
disorder is not based on an understanding of its pathophysiology but
remains empricial: delivery of the fetus and placenta. The high
maternal and fetal morbidity and mortality associated with
preeclampsia largely result from the iatrogenic preterm interruption
of affected pregnancies. The cellular and molecular biology that
underlies this syndrome only recently has begun to be elucidated.
Abnormalities of trophoblast differentiation and invasion have been
discovered by Dr. Fisher and colleagues. Studies in my laboratory
have focused on mechanisms of maternal vascular endothelial
dysfunction in preeclampsia, with an emphasis on the biochemical
pathways involved in abnormal prostanoid production. Data from our
laboratory and those of others indicate that a preponderance of
vasoconstrictor prostanoids are produced in vessels and tissues
frompreeclamptic women. Methods and Results: We have selected a
bioassay (acute release of human umbilical vein endothelial cell
prostaglandins) as a paradigm to identify the placenta- and
plasma-derived factors responsible for endothelial cell activation in
preeclampsia. Our data indicate that the enzyme responsible for
prostaglandin synthesis in activated endothelial cells is a member of
the family of phospholipases A2. Assays of enzyme activity and
immunoblotting of specific PLA2 isoforms are in progress to
characterize the enzyme(s) induced in activated cells. Fatty acid
substrate transport in the circulation by albumin isoforms, and
ultimately into maternal endothelial cells, also appears to be
abnormal in preeclampsia. Using isoelectric focusing we haveshown
that plasma concentrations of pI=4.8 albumin, an isoform that is
relatively rich in fatty acids, are increased significantly in women
with preeclampsia compared to normal pregnant controls. We propose
that specific fatty acids bound to plasma albumin are the precursors
responsible for increased prostaglandin production. Mass spectroscopy
will be used to identify the fatty acids associated with plasma
albumin isolated from preeclamptic and normal pregnant women.
Discussion: The proposed studies will characterize the substrates and
enzymes which perturb prostaglandin biosynthesis in preeclampsia. An
understanding of these molecules should provide targets for the future
development of novel therapeutic antagonists for the rational
treatment and possible prophylaxis of preeclampsia.
